Job Description

Performance Foodservice, a broadline distributor under Performance Food Group (PFG), plays a vital role in America's food supply chain by delivering a wide range of food products to diverse local customers. Their clientele includes independent restaurants, hotels, healthcare facilities, schools, and quick-service eateries. The company prides itself on the collaborative efforts of its team, which comprises sales representatives, chefs, consultants, and foodservice experts who work closely with each customer to offer tailored guidance on improving operations, menu development, product selection, and operational strategies. This relationship-driven approach is at the heart of Performance Foodservice’s commitment to not just delivering quality food but also supporting the dreams of independent restaurant owners and foodservice operators.

Performance Foodservice is currently seeking qualified and dedicated Food and Food Service Delivery Drivers to join its team. This role is essential to ensuring the consistent and safe delivery of products across intrastate and interstate routes, both local and over-the-road (OTR), including shuttle and overnight assignments. Drivers are entrusted with operating tractor-trailers or straight trucks, managing the pick-up and delivery of food and related supplies to customers ranging from restaurants to healthcare providers. This position requires adherence to strict safety standards and Department of Transportation (DOT) regulations, underscoring the company’s focus on safety and professionalism.

Offered employment is full-time, with competitive pay that averages around $83,000 annually. The scheduling is typically Monday through Friday, with potential layovers and occasional Saturday work, featuring varied start and end times that may result in shifts exceeding 12 hours. Both 4- and 5-day work week options are available to provide flexibility. The requirement of a valid CDL Class A license is mandatory for this role.

Drivers at Performance Foodservice do more than transport orders; they are the face of the company in the communities they serve. Their responsibilities include engaging professionally with customers, accurately managing delivery paperwork, inspecting vehicles for safety compliance, and ensuring the secure and damage-free transfer of products. Additionally, drivers may be involved in collecting payments, handling equipment, and supporting operational logistics at delivery sites. Job Requirements

  • High school diploma or GED
  • Minimum 12 months commercial driving experience
  • Valid CDL-A license
  • Minimum age of 21
  • Meet state licensing and certification requirements
  • Clean motor vehicle report for the past three years
  • Pass post offer drug test and criminal background check
  • Pass road test
  • Current or able to secure DOT health card
  • Ability to lift and handle freight weighing 10-90 pounds
  • Willingness to work varied hours including potential Saturdays and layovers

Job Duties

  • Drive a tractor trailer or straight truck for intrastate and interstate deliveries
  • Communicate professionally with customers, vendors, and co-workers
  • Perform pre and post-trip safety inspections
  • Ensure compliance with Department of Transportation regulations
  • Inspect and secure freight loads
  • Complete all required delivery paperwork accurately
  • Load and unload products and transport items to designated customer areas
  • Verify deliveries and obtain customer signatures
  • Collect payments when required
  • Maintain cleanliness and safety of vehicles and loading areas
